Specifying Height Safety at Design Stage: A Guide for Architects

Height safety is often treated as a contractor’s problem. It shouldn’t be. By the time a roofing contractor arrives on site, many of the decisions that determine how safely people will work at height for the next 25 years have already been made, or missed, in the specification.

For architects and specifiers working to NBS conventions, embedding height safety requirements early is both a professional responsibility and a practical advantage.

Why Height Safety Should Be Addressed at RIBA Stage 2 or 3

The Construction (Design and Management) Regulations 2015 place a clear duty on designers to eliminate or reduce foreseeable risk during construction, maintenance, and eventual demolition. Fall from height remains the leading cause of fatal injury in UK construction, according to the Health and Safety Executive.

Addressing access and fall protection at Stages 2 or 3 means the structural engineer can accommodate loading requirements for mansafe anchors, fixed walkways, and roof-level lifeline systems before the frame is designed. Specifying these systems retrospectively almost always increases cost and sometimes compromises the integrity of the original design.

What Should Architects Include in Their Specifications?

Height safety specification typically falls within NBS sections covering roof construction, metalwork, and safety equipment. The following systems warrant early consideration:

Mansafe horizontal lifeline systems are continuous cable or track systems that allow maintenance workers to traverse a roof or façade while remaining attached to a fall arrest anchor at all times. Anchor point loads must be coordinated with the structural engineer.

Fixed access walkways provide a defined, slip-resistant route across fragile or vulnerable roof surfaces. They also protect the roof membrane from foot traffic damage, which has a direct effect on maintenance costs.

Static line systems and anchor points serve as discrete, permanent attachment points for operative harnesses. Positioning should reflect the likely maintenance tasks: gutter inspection, plant access, and glazing maintenance each require different anchor locations.

Edge protection and collective fall prevention may be required during construction as well as for ongoing maintenance. Specifying proprietary parapet upstands or edge rail systems within the architectural package removes ambiguity from the tender stage.

How to Write an Effective NBS-Style Clause for Height Safety

A well-structured NBS clause names the system type, references the relevant British Standard (BS EN 795 for anchor devices, BS 8560 for the design of buildings that facilitate the safe maintenance of roofs), and defines the performance requirement rather than prescribing a single manufacturer.

A performance-based approach gives contractors flexibility to tender competitively while ensuring the installed system meets the design intent. Include requirements for third-party certification, installer competency, and a commissioning inspection as part of the clause.

It is also worth specifying that the system supplier provides a maintenance log and recommended inspection intervals at handover. This supports the building owner’s ongoing duty under the Work at Height Regulations 2005 and reduces the likelihood of the system falling into disrepair between planned maintenance cycles.

Coordinating Height Safety Across the Project Team

Specification alone is insufficient if the information does not reach the right people at the right time. The height safety strategy should be reflected in the pre-construction Health and Safety Plan and carried through into the Health and Safety File, which the principal designer is responsible for under CDM 2015.

Coordinating with the structural engineer on anchor loads, with the roofing contractor on walkway substrate compatibility, and with the facilities management team on long-term access requirements will produce a more cohesive outcome than treating height safety as an isolated product selection.
